Our Favorite Outdoor Toys and Activities
Sand and Water Table
I thought I would start with our favorite outdoor toy. I bought this table in 2013 and it is still going strong. Definitely worth the $70 I paid for it. My kids have so much fun with it. Aside from using it for just plain sand and water play, we have used it for all kinds of things. We have floated paper boats in it and even had a toy car wash with it! My kids LOVE this thing!
Little Red Wagon
Where would we be without our little red wagon? This toy is awesome for toting siblings around the yard or hauling sticks and stones. My brothers and I use to race in our little red wagon. These toys are awesome and I think every kids should have one!
Swing Set
We’ve always had a plain old metal swing set in our backyard until we moved on base. There really isn’t room here for a swing set, and we have two play grounds in walking distance. I am considering getting them some sort of climber or tire swing for our back yard, though.
Sidewalk Chalk
Sidewalk chalk is cheap and versatile! We use it to play hop scotch and to even do number subtraction! I love putting sidewalk chalk in the kids’ Easter baskets. It’s definitely a staple for us all spring and summer.
Bikes and Scooters
Bikes and scooters are great for exercise and kids love them! My seven year old just learned how to ride his bike without training wheels, so that’s very exciting.

Our Favorite Outdoor Activities for Spring
Watch Caterpillars turn into Butterflies
We did this last year and it was so fun! We probably won’t do it again this year, but we will next for, sure. Such an amazing experience!
Family Hikes
Whether it’s just a walk around the neighborhood or a trip to a local garden, family hikes are great fun. Spring is the perfect time to do them before the weather gets too unbearably hot!
Gardening
We can’t forget gardening. Almost every year we plant some sort of garden. The kids learn so much by participating with us. This past weekend my kids helped my parents with their garden and they had so much fun.
